The length of a rectangle is 10 m less than three times the width, and the area of the rectangle is 77 m2 . find the dimensions
Anna007 [38]
Let the width be x, the length is then 3x-10
Area of a rectangle is length times width: x(3x-10)=77 => 3x^2-10x-77=0
Factor this quadratic equation: (x-7)(3x+11)=0 =.x=7 or x=-11/3
width cannot be negative, so the only answer is x=7
width is 7m, length is 11m
